WebDuring the modern period the Chinese Buddhist canon has been translated, edited, digitized, and condensed as well as internationalized, contested, and ritualized. The well-known accomplishment of this modern transformation is the compilation of the Taisho Canon during the 1920s. Webdigitization of Taisho Canon and Manji Continued Canon. Today, CBETA offers the Taisho Tripitaka (2373 titles in 8982 fascicles), Manji continued Canon (1229 titles in 5060 fascicles and Jaixing canon (285 titles 1659 fascicles and other, both on CD-ROM and on the CBETA website free of cost (Tu 2016, p. 321-335).
